Product Details

Description
The Crock-Pot® Casserole Crock makes family dinners, potlucks and parties easier than ever. Its oval design is the perfect size and shape to prepare everyone's favorite casserole dishes, dips, desserts and more. It's ideal for make-ahead meals you and your family can come home to - simplifying mealtime. The unique stoneware is also oven-safe for use in conventional ovens to cook and warm. With portability in mind, the Casserole Crock™ uses our Cook & Carry® locking lid system for easy transport, without spills or mess. It also makes entertaining easy so you can prepare a casserole or dish in advance, then let it slow cook. You can enjoy your guests or get to other party preparations. When your kitchen oven is working on overload, the Crock-Pot® Casserole Crock™ can be your lifesaver by freeing up space in the oven.
  • Manual controls - high, low and warm settings
  • Dishwasher-safe stoneware and lid
  • Cord wraps for neat and easy transport

Care & Maintenance
    • ALWAYS turn your unit off, unplug it from the electrical outlet, and allow it to cool before cleaning. Dishwasher safe parts can be washed in the dishwasher or with hot, soapy water. Do not use abrasive cleaning compounds or scouring pads. A cloth, sponge, or rubber spatula will usually remove residue. To remove water spots and other stains, use a non-abrasive cleaner or vinegar. As with any fine ceramic, the stoneware and lid will not withstand sudden temperature changes. Do not wash the stoneware or lid with cold water when they are hot.

Rated 5 out of 5 by from Great size I bought this pot during holidays of 2015. In addition the great locking travel lid, It has turned out to be such a great size for my small empty nest family. It is good for casseroles for two, two chicken breasts w/ BBQ or other sauce, 3-4 boneless pork chops w/any favorite seasoning, small pork loin or beef tips au jus, stuffed peppers, side dishes, even desserts. Anything that would sit at the bottom of other slow cookers and not fill 2/3 of the space like recommended. I use mine frequently, more than I use my 4,5,6 qt. cookers. For me shallow is good.

Rated 4 out of 5 by from cute and very useful I find myself using this all the time; I would of given it 5 stars. If it were not for the lid. It get water under the handle from condensation and when you wash it, very difficult to get it all out unless you take screwdriver and loosen it, drain, then re-tighten. I think this is design flaw, should have rubber stopper or something - it just an are for bacteria to grow.
